From a decision-making standpoint, prospective families should press for a robust onboarding and oversight framework. Request a dedicated care manager who will stay engaged across shifts, insist on written care plans with measurable goals, and confirm backup coverage arrangements so no lapse can occur during transition times. Ask for real-time communication protocols, such as caregiver updates after each visit and a clear point of contact for scheduling changes. Verify that the staff has ongoing professional development and that the agency’s leadership remains accessible when issues arise. In practice, the strongest reviews emphasize partnerships with office staff who treat families as collaborators, not afterthoughts, and that is a critical predictor of sustained satisfaction.

Located in Springfield, Pennsylvania, this area offers a convenient and bustling community with various amenities suitable for senior living. Within close proximity, there are several pharmacies such as Walmart Pharmacy and GIANT Pharmacy for easy access to prescription medications. Nearby parks like Ellson Glen Park provide opportunities for outdoor recreation and relaxation. Dining options include familiar chains like McDonald's and Cracker Barrel, as well as Chinese cuisine at Wing Hing Chinese Restaurant. For medical needs, there are reputable healthcare facilities such as Riddle Hospital and Bryn Mawr Hospital nearby. Public transportation via SEPTA and rental car services are available for easy travel, along with the Philadelphia International Airport located just 7 miles away. Places of worship like St Anastasia Rectory offer spiritual nourishment, while cafes like 320 Market Cafe provide a cozy atmosphere to enjoy a cup of coffee. Overall, this area in Springfield presents a well-rounded environment with essential services tailored to seniors' needs.

Fecal Incontinence in Older Adults: A Comprehensive Guide
Fecal incontinence, prevalent among older adults, arises from factors like weakened pelvic muscles and nerve damage, significantly affecting well-being and social interactions. Diagnosis involves clinical evaluation and tests to inform tailored treatments, while caregivers and preventive measures can aid in managing the condition effectively.
Recognizing the Journey: Understanding and Navigating Anticipatory Grief
Anticipatory grief is an emotional response to the impending loss of a loved one, characterized by complex emotions such as sadness and anger, and involves navigating stages similar to those identified by Kübler-Ross. Coping strategies are vital for managing this process, emphasizing compassionate communication, self-care, and support groups while recognizing the cultural influences on grieving.
Encouraging Participation in Adult Day Care: A Guide to Supporting a Hesitant Parent
Adult day care programs offer essential support and activities for older adults, yet many hesitate to participate due to concerns about independence and stigma. To alleviate these apprehensions, families should facilitate open discussions, explore financial resources, suggest trial visits, and collaborate with healthcare providers to highlight the benefits of such services for both the participants and their caregivers.
